Gloria B. Overton, 84, Was Devoted to Church

Gloria B. Overton, 84, of Cape May Court House, N.J., died on Saturday, Oct. 12, at the home of her daughter, Sherye Chase Pearson.

Born in Mobile, Ala., she was a district sales manager for Avon Products in New York city. She had lived in Cape May Court House for the past four years, coming from Martha's Vineyard, where she was a full-time resident for 20 years and a summer resident for a decade before that.

She was a member of Christ Gospel Church in Whitesboro, N.J.; the Apostolic House of Prayer on Martha's Vineyard and Love Tabernacle Church of Yonkers, N.Y. She was a very active church member.

She was a fashion model with the Bradford Agency of New York city and had graduated from the Institute of Fashion and Design of New York. She was a lifetime member of the Auxiliary #198 of the NAACP.

She is survived by her son, Frank Alexander Overton of Massachusetts; two daughters, Sherye Chase Person of Cape May Court House and a special daughter, Wanda Jean Myers of Martha's Vineyard; two daughters in law, Wanda Overton of Brooklyn and Denise Van Allen Overton of Boston; 12 grandchildren and one great-grandchild. She was predeceased by her two sons, Lenwood Joseph Overton and Joseph (Jay) Lenwood Overton.
